Community Quilters We are located in Excelsior Springs, Missouri.

Community Quilters is a Missouri-registered nonprofit organization dedicated to quilting, education, community outreach, and making a difference—one stitch at a time.

Do you have a quilt top you can't finish?

Maybe life got busy. Maybe you lost interest in the project. Maybe the person who started it is no longer able to finish it.

Whatever the reason, that unfinished project doesn't have to stay tucked away in a closet.

Community Quilters accepts unfinished quilts and quilt tops that may be completed and donated to someone in need.

Depending on the project, we may be able to:
🪡 Add borders or complete the top
🪡 Add batting and backing
🪡 Quilt and bind it
🪡 Turn blocks or partial projects into something new

Your unfinished project can still become warmth, comfort and hope for someone else.

Donations can be dropped off at Heartland Quilt Supply Co., 216 S Marietta St. in Excelsior Springs, MO.

We turn donations into comfort.

Community Quilters is a registered Missouri nonprofit organization based in Excelsior Springs, MO, with a simple mission: providing handmade comfort items to people in need.

We accept donations of:
❤️ Quilting cotton and usable fabric
❤️ Unfinished quilt tops and projects
❤️ Finished adult and children's quilts
❤️ Batting and backing fabric
❤️ Other useful quilting materials and supplies, even sewing machines

Your donation might become a quilt, a wheelchair quilt, a walker or wheelchair organization bag, or another comfort item created to meet a need in our community.

Have fabric or a quilt to donate? Send us a Facebook message or drop off donations at Heartland Quilt Supply Co. in Excelsior Springs. They will make sure they get to us.
